Botorrita is a municipality of 574 residents located in the province of Zaragoza, , Spain. Botorrita is known for the archeological artefacts found there, such as the Botorrita plaques. The Romans knew it as Contrebia Belaisca. is situated 4½ km northeast of Montesol.
